Bring the chill back to your A/C with the Four Seasons A/C Evaporator Core 64163 — the heat exchanger where cold refrigerant absorbs heat from the cabin air your blower pushes across it, cooling and dehumidifying the air before it reaches the vents. It drops in as a direct-fit replacement for the 2020-2025 Ford Escape, 2020-2025 Lincoln Corsair, 2021-2025 Ford Bronco Sport, 2021-2025 Ford Mustang Mach-E, 2022-2025 Ford Maverick, and 2024-2025 Lincoln Nautilus (all engines).
Signs the original evaporator core may need attention include weak or warm vent air, poor cooling, or a refrigerant leak; because those symptoms can have other causes, diagnose the system first — if a failed evaporator core is the cause, this replaces it.
